Defining Modern Elegance in Architecture

Luxury houses on Pinterest frequently feature clean lines, expansive glass walls, and open-concept floor plans that define contemporary architecture. These designs emphasize a seamless connection between indoor and outdoor spaces, creating a sense of openness and tranquility. You will find pins showcasing minimalist facades paired with luxurious materials like natural stone, polished concrete, and sleek metal finishes. This combination of simplicity and high-end materials is the hallmark of modern elegance, providing a timeless appeal that remains relevant year after year.

Practical Tips for Using Pinterest Effectively




















To get the most out of your search for luxury houses, it is helpful to use specific keywords and board organization. Instead of a general search, try terms like "modern mountain retreat" or "coastal villa interior" to narrow down results. Creating dedicated boards for different rooms or styles helps you compare options side-by-side. Saving high-quality images from reputable architects or interior designers ensures that the inspiration is both realistic and achievable, bridging the gap between dream design and actual renovation.
